Open the documentsWhat a grant of permission means
The process from here
Permission has been granted, usually subject to conditions listed on the decision notice, some of which must be discharged before work starts. The decision notice on the council portal sets out exactly what was approved.
Work must normally begin within three years of the decision or the permission lapses. Neighbours cannot appeal a grant; challenging one means judicial review of how the decision was made, within tight time limits.
About advertising applications
How this application type works
Advertisement consent controls signs, hoardings and other adverts. The council may only judge two things: amenity, meaning the effect on the appearance of the building and area, and public safety, chiefly whether a sign distracts road users or obstructs sight lines. Other planning considerations, such as competition between businesses, do not apply.
